LAS CRUCES, N.M. (AP) — Christian Cook had 17 points and made two free throws with 12 seconds left to rally New Mexico State to a 67-65 victory over Jacksonville State on Saturday night.

Cook shot 6 for 11, including 3 for 6 from beyond the arc for the Aggies (11-12, 5-3 Conference USA). Jordan Rawls scored 14 points, going 5 of 11 (2 for 5 from 3-point range). Kaosi Ezeagu finished 6 of 7 from the floor to finish with 12 points, while adding eight rebounds.

Quincy Clark led the way for the Gamecocks (11-12, 3-5) with 16 points and five assists. Jacksonville State also got 13 points and two steals from KyKy Tandy. Juwan Perdue also had 12 points and 12 rebounds.
